| single-disc overview of the early output of l.a. art-punkers urinals ...
these minimal/terse jabs have been getting under my skin as of recent ; they were hugely influential on, amongst others, the minutemen (who went as far a covering “ack ack ack ack” on “3-way tie (for last)”) ... while there are ties from urinals to the concurrent lafms scene, for the most part this is linear, scaled back song-based short-sharp-shock (average song-length hovers in the 60-90 second range) ... |

| urinals - negative capability ... check it out! [wlr003]
finally repressed! this highly regarded collection of historical tracks by seminal l.a. punkers the urinals. now in their 30th year, what better time to celebrate the band that inspired a generation of punk, art-punk, post-punk, and pop-punk bands, from the minutemen and gun club to yo la tengo and butthole surfers, in addition to newer bands such as no age, the dishes, the reds, and st-37.
this 31 song collection features such urinals classics as "i'm a bug", "black hole", and "ack ack ack ack", in addition to a selection of madcap covers such as the "jetson's theme", and songs by soft machine and roky erickson. recordings were made between 1978 and 1980, during the heyday of american punk. includes the complete "urinals," "another ep," and "sex/go away girl" 7-inch material, 3 tunes from long out-of-print compilations, several unreleased studio and rehearsal pieces, and samples from the band's archive of live tapes, including their very first performance as a three-piece. also includes nifty color sticker insert of the cover image. |
